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in Hale

The window service market for residents of Hale, Missouri, is characteristic of a rural area. Homeowners typically rely on reputable contractors from larger nearby towns like Carrollton (the county seat), Chillicothe, and Marshall. The competition among these regional providers is healthy, which helps maintain service quality and fair pricing. The average quality of service is quite high, as these businesses survive on word-of-mouth and long-term community reputation. Typical pricing for a standard double-hung window replacement can range from **$450 to $900 per window**, including professional installation. Factors that influence the final cost include the window material (vinyl being the most common and cost-effective), glass package (double-pane Low-E is standard), the brand, and any custom sizing or special features like impact resistance or enhanced security. For a full-home window replacement project, homeowners should budget accordingly based on the number of windows.

1What is the typical cost range for a full home window replacement in Hale, MO?

For a standard-sized home in Hale, a full window replacement typ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on the number of windows, materials (vinyl, wood, fiberglass), and energy efficiency ratings. Missouri's climate, with hot, humid summers and cold winters, makes investing in double-pane Low-E windows a wise choice for long-term energy savings, though they increase the upfront cost. Always get itemized quotes from local installers that include removal, installation, and cleanup.

2When is the best time of year to schedule window installation in our area?

The ideal times are late spring (May) and early fall (September-October) in Hale. These periods typically offer mild, dry weather, which is crucial for a proper installation seal and allows for adequate ventilation for caulking and sealants to cure. Avoiding the peak humidity of summer and the freezing temperatures of winter helps prevent installation issues and ensures your home's comfort isn't compromised during the project.

3Are there specific local building codes or permits required for window replacement in Hale?

Yes, while many straightforward replacement projects in Hale may not require a permit if the window opening size isn't changed, it's essential to check with the City of Hale or Carroll County building department. Missouri building codes, which incorporate energy efficiency standards, must be followed. A reputable local installer will handle this verification and any necessary permits, ensuring compliance with regional requirements for safety and insulation.

4How do I choose a reliable window installation contractor in the Hale area?

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have verifiable local references in Hale or nearby communities like Bosworth or Carrollton. Look for experience with Missouri's weather extremes, as proper installation is key to preventing air/water infiltration. Check their standing with the Missouri Attorney General's Office and the BBB, and ensure they offer a strong warranty covering both the product and their labor.

5What are common post-installation issues specific to our climate, and how are they prevented?

Condensation between panes and air drafts are common concerns, often stemming from improper sealing or low-quality windows not suited for Missouri's temperature swings. A quality local installer will use proper flashing techniques and high-performance sealants to create a weather-tight barrier. They should also ensure the windows have an appropriate U-factor and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) rating for our mixed climate to minimize future problems.
